Quantum plasmas have attracted baronial interest due to their enormous applications in dense plasma particularly in different astrophysical and cosmological systems e.g., core of big planets like Jupiter and white dwarf stars magnetars , warm dense matter, interstellar or molecular clouds, planetary rings, comets, interior of white dwarf stars, etc as well as in semiconductors, thin films and nanometallic structures , quantum diodes, compressed plasmas produced by intense laser and charged particle beams for producing fusion energy and highenergy electrons and positrons. This field is opening a window of new opportunities for carrying out cutting edge fundamental research and controlled thermonuclear fusion from compressed plasmas employing magnetoinertial confinement schemes that use high energy density plasmas created by ultraintense laser and relativistic charged particle beams. In this book, we have studied the nonlinear propagations of quantum ionacoustic, quantum dustionacoustic, and quantum dustacoustic waves in dense quantum plasmas theoretically. Readers of this book could gather a sound knowledge about this interesting field of science.
